Security concerns facing the United States today are broader and more complex than at any time in our history. They range from concerns arising from threats to systems that allow society to control intergroup and interpersonal conflict to more recently recognized concerns associated with threats to social and economic systems, and threats to the natural/environmental systems on upon which society depends. Each major type of threat represents a form of "fat-tailed risk," where extreme consequences are far more likely than expected but possess significant uncertainty regarding their severity and timing. Each type of threat shares the common characteristic that some elements are non-negotiable because they contain requirements that society must address to avoid or suffer irreparable consequences. Based on these assessments, we discuss the implications of societal threats on the development of global institutions, cooperation, social justice and human rights.
